A Glimpse into the Mimosoideae Subfamily
Mimosoideae, belonging to the legume family (Fabaceae), is a diverse group encompassing trees, shrubs, and herbs. Think of the iconic acacia trees of the African savanna, or the delicate, touch-sensitive leaves of Mimosa pudica. With around 40 genera and over 3,000 species, this subfamily presents a treasure trove of options for gardeners of all levels.
From the familiar to the exotic, Mimosoideae plants share some common characteristics, including:
- Compound leaves: Typically bipinnate, resembling feathery plumes.
- Globular flower heads: Clusters of small, showy flowers, often with prominent stamens.
- Legumes (pods): The characteristic fruit of the legume family, containing seeds.

The Power of Nitrogen Fixation
Many Mimosoideae species are nitrogen fixers. This means they have a symbiotic relationship with bacteria in their roots, converting atmospheric nitrogen into a form plants can use. This naturally fertilizes the soil, benefiting both the Mimosoideae plant itself and any nearby companion plants.
Nitrogen fixation reduces the need for synthetic fertilizers, promoting a healthier and more sustainable garden ecosystem.

Defining Mimosoideae: A Closer Look
Mimosoideae plants share several key traits:
-
Bipinnate Leaves: This is a hallmark of the subfamily. Their leaves are compound, resembling delicate, feathery plumes. Imagine intricate, almost fern-like structures – that's the essence of bipinnate leaves.
-
Globular Flower Heads: Rather than individual, distinct flowers, Mimosoideae typically boast clusters of small flowers densely packed together in spherical or cylindrical heads. These create a visually stunning effect, often resembling powder puffs or bottlebrushes.
-
Prominent Stamens: The flowers' most striking feature is the long, colorful stamens that extend far beyond the petals. These give the flower heads their characteristic fluffy appearance and are highly attractive to pollinators.
-
Legumes (Pods): As members of the legume family, Mimosoideae produce pods containing seeds. These pods vary in shape and size depending on the species, from long and slender to short and stout.
Popular Genera: A World of Variety
Within Mimosoideae lies an incredible diversity of species, each with its own unique charm and growing requirements. Let's explore a few popular genera:
Acacia: The Iconic Symbol
Acacia is perhaps the most well-known genus within Mimosoideae.
These trees and shrubs are native to warm, arid regions around the world and are famous for their drought tolerance and distinctive appearance.
Think of the classic African savanna landscape – many of those iconic trees are acacias!
- Growing Requirements: Acacias generally prefer well-drained soil and plenty of sunlight. They are relatively low-maintenance once established, making them ideal for xeriscaping (water-wise gardening).
Albizia: The Shade Provider
Albizia, also known as silk trees, are fast-growing trees prized for their delicate, fern-like foliage and showy, pom-pom-like flowers.
They provide welcome shade and are often used as ornamental trees in parks and gardens.
Growing Requirements: Albizias thrive in full sun and well-drained soil. Be mindful of their rapid growth and potential invasiveness in some regions.
Mimosa pudica: The Sensitive Plant
Mimosa pudica, also known as the sensitive plant or touch-me-not, is a fascinating curiosity. Its leaves dramatically fold inward when touched, a defense mechanism against herbivores.
It's a small, herbaceous plant often grown as a novelty or educational specimen.
- Growing Requirements: Mimosa pudica prefers warm, humid conditions and well-drained soil. It can be grown in containers or as a groundcover in frost-free climates.

Sunlight Requirements: Basking in the Light
Sunlight is the fuel that powers plant growth, and Mimosoideae are no exception.
Adequate sunlight is essential for photosynthesis, the process by which plants convert light energy into chemical energy. Without enough sunlight, plants become weak, leggy, and produce fewer flowers.
Most Mimosoideae species thrive in full sun, requiring at least 6-8 hours of direct sunlight per day.
However, some species can tolerate partial shade, especially in hotter climates. Understanding the specific light requirements of your chosen Mimosoideae is crucial.
For instance, Acacias generally crave full sun, while some Albizia varieties can handle afternoon shade. Observe your plants and adjust their location if they appear to be struggling.
Soil pH: Striking the Right Balance
Soil pH measures the acidity or alkalinity of the soil. This measurement significantly affects the availability of nutrients to plants.
Mimosoideae generally prefer a slightly acidic to neutral soil pH, typically ranging from 6.0 to 7.0.
Why is pH important?
At this range, essential nutrients are readily available for the plant to absorb. When the pH is too high or too low, certain nutrients become locked up in the soil, leading to deficiencies even if those nutrients are present.
Testing Your Soil
Before planting, it's wise to test your soil's pH. You can purchase a soil testing kit at most garden centers. Follow the instructions carefully to obtain an accurate reading. Alternatively, you can send a soil sample to a local agricultural extension office for professional testing.
Adjusting Soil pH
If your soil pH is too high (alkaline), you can lower it by adding soil sulfur or peat moss. These amendments gradually increase acidity.
If your soil pH is too low (acidic), you can raise it by adding lime (calcium carbonate). Always follow the product instructions carefully and retest the soil after making amendments.
It is best to make adjustments gradually over time for the health of the plants.
Watering Techniques: Finding the Sweet Spot
Water is life, but too much or too little can be detrimental. Mimosoideae prefer well-drained soil and are susceptible to root rot if overwatered.
Effective Watering Practices
Water deeply but infrequently, allowing the soil to dry out slightly between waterings. This encourages deep root growth, making the plant more drought-tolerant.
The frequency of watering will depend on several factors, including the climate, soil type, and the plant's size.
During hot, dry periods, you may need to water more frequently. In cooler, wetter weather, reduce watering accordingly.
Avoid overhead watering, as this can promote fungal diseases. Instead, water at the base of the plant, directing the water towards the root zone.
Preventing Overwatering
Ensure your planting location has good drainage. Amend heavy clay soils with organic matter, such as compost or well-rotted manure, to improve drainage.
Watch for signs of overwatering, such as yellowing leaves, wilting, and soft, mushy stems. If you suspect overwatering, reduce watering frequency and allow the soil to dry out completely.

Seed Scarification: Awakening Dormant Potential
Many Mimosoideae seeds possess a tough outer layer that prevents moisture from penetrating and initiating germination. This dormancy mechanism is a natural survival strategy, but it requires us to intervene to ensure successful cultivation. Seed scarification is the process of weakening or breaking down this outer layer, allowing water to reach the embryo and trigger germination.
Think of it as gently nudging the seed awake, letting it know it's time to grow! Here are a few proven methods:
Sandpaper Scarification: The Gentle Abrasion
This method involves gently rubbing the seeds with sandpaper to thin the seed coat.
Use fine-grit sandpaper and lightly abrade the seed surface, being careful not to damage the inner embryo.
A few gentle strokes are usually sufficient.
Hot Water Soak: Simulating Nature's Fire
This technique mimics the effects of a bushfire, a common occurrence in many Mimosoideae habitats.
Carefully pour hot (but not boiling) water over the seeds and allow them to soak for 12-24 hours.
The heat helps to soften the seed coat, while the soaking allows moisture to penetrate.
Mechanical Scarification: A More Direct Approach
For larger, tougher seeds, you can use a sharp knife or file to carefully nick the seed coat.
Exercise extreme caution when using sharp tools.
The goal is to create a small opening without damaging the embryo.
Regardless of the method you choose, remember to observe the seeds closely. You're looking for a slight swelling, indicating that water has penetrated the seed coat.
Propagation Methods: Multiplying Your Mimosoideae
Once you have successfully scarified your seeds (if necessary for your chosen species), or if you're opting for vegetative propagation, it's time to move on to the actual propagation process. Mimosoideae can be propagated through several methods, each with its own advantages:
Seed Propagation: A Rewarding Start
Starting from seed is a rewarding experience, allowing you to witness the entire life cycle of your Mimosoideae.
Sow the scarified seeds in a well-draining seed-starting mix.
Keep the soil consistently moist but not waterlogged.
Maintain a warm environment, ideally around 70-75°F (21-24°C).
Germination times vary depending on the species, so be patient!
Cuttings: Cloning Your Favorites
Vegetative propagation through cuttings allows you to create exact copies of your favorite Mimosoideae plants, preserving desirable traits.
Take semi-hardwood cuttings from healthy, actively growing plants.
Dip the cut ends in rooting hormone to encourage root development.
Insert the cuttings into a well-draining rooting medium, such as perlite or vermiculite.
Maintain high humidity by covering the cuttings with a plastic bag or humidity dome.
Rooting can take several weeks, so be patient and monitor the cuttings regularly.

The Right Touch: Fertilizing Legumes
Mimosoideae, being legumes, have a unique relationship with nitrogen.
Their roots host symbiotic bacteria that naturally fix atmospheric nitrogen, converting it into a usable form for the plant.
This means that they generally require less nitrogen fertilization than other plants.
Why Low-Nitrogen Fertilizers?
Excessive nitrogen can disrupt the natural nitrogen-fixing process, potentially harming the beneficial bacteria. It can also lead to excessive foliage growth at the expense of flowering.
Choose fertilizers formulated for legumes or those with a low nitrogen (N) content compared to phosphorus (P) and potassium (K).
A balanced fertilizer with a ratio like 5-10-10 or even 0-10-10 is often a good choice.
Always follow the manufacturer’s instructions carefully to avoid over-fertilizing.
It's often best to err on the side of under-fertilizing, observing your plant's growth and adjusting accordingly.
Consider supplementing with compost or well-rotted manure to provide a slow-release source of nutrients.
Pruning for Health and Beauty
Pruning is an essential practice that can promote healthy growth, enhance flowering, and maintain the desired shape of your Mimosoideae.
Reasons for Pruning
-
Removing Dead or Diseased Wood: This prevents the spread of disease and improves overall plant health.
-
Shaping the Plant: Pruning helps maintain an attractive form and prevent overcrowding.
-
Encouraging Air Circulation: Proper airflow reduces the risk of fungal diseases.
-
Promoting Flowering: Removing spent flowers encourages the plant to produce more blooms.
Optimal Timing
The best time to prune Mimosoideae is typically after flowering, during the dormant season (late winter or early spring).
Avoid heavy pruning during active growth periods, as this can stress the plant.
Pruning Techniques
-
Deadheading: Remove spent flowers to encourage further blooming. Simply snip off the flower head just below the flower.
-
Thinning: Remove crowded or crossing branches to improve air circulation and light penetration. Cut back to a main branch or bud.
-
Shaping: Trim branches to maintain the desired shape and size of the plant. Make cuts at a 45-degree angle, just above a bud facing the direction you want the new growth to go.
-
Rejuvenation Pruning: For older, overgrown plants, you can remove up to one-third of the oldest branches to encourage new growth.
Always use clean, sharp pruning tools to prevent the spread of disease.
Guarding Against Pests and Diseases
Even with the best care, Mimosoideae can occasionally be affected by pests or diseases. Early detection and prompt action are key to preventing serious problems.
Common Pests
-
Spider Mites: These tiny pests can cause leaves to become stippled and yellowed. They thrive in dry conditions. Increase humidity and spray plants with a strong jet of water or insecticidal soap.
-
Aphids: These small, sap-sucking insects can cause distorted growth and sticky honeydew. Control them with insecticidal soap, neem oil, or by introducing beneficial insects like ladybugs.
-
Mealybugs: These white, cottony pests suck sap from stems and leaves. Remove them manually with a cotton swab dipped in alcohol or treat with insecticidal soap.
Common Diseases
-
Root Rot: This fungal disease is caused by overwatering and poor drainage. Ensure proper drainage and avoid overwatering. In severe cases, you may need to repot the plant with fresh soil.
-
Powdery Mildew: This fungal disease appears as a white, powdery coating on leaves. Improve air circulation, avoid overhead watering, and treat with a fungicide if necessary.
-
Fungal Leaf Spots: Various fungal diseases can cause spots on leaves. Remove affected leaves, improve air circulation, and treat with a fungicide if needed.
Preventative Measures
- Good Air Circulation: Ensure plants have adequate space and airflow to prevent fungal diseases.
- Proper Watering: Avoid overwatering, which can lead to root rot.
- Regular Inspection: Check plants regularly for signs of pests or diseases.
- Healthy Soil: Use well-draining soil and amend with compost to promote healthy root growth.

Acacia: The Sunshine Lovers
The Acacia genus, with its hundreds of diverse species, thrives in sunny conditions and well-drained soil. Understanding the specific climate and soil preferences of your chosen Acacia variety is key.
Acacias are sun-worshippers, generally needing at least six hours of direct sunlight daily.
Climate Considerations
Most Acacia species thrive in warm, temperate climates.
Some are drought-tolerant, making them ideal for arid regions, while others require more consistent moisture. Research the specific needs of your Acacia species.
Soil Preferences
Well-drained soil is crucial to prevent root rot, a common problem for Acacias.
They generally prefer slightly acidic to neutral soil pH. Amend heavy clay soils with organic matter to improve drainage.
Pruning for Shape and Health
Pruning can help maintain the desired shape and size of your Acacia and promote healthy growth.
The best time to prune is after flowering. Remove any dead, damaged, or crossing branches.
Albizia: The Shade Provider with a Word of Caution
Albizia, known for its delicate, feathery foliage and beautiful blooms, offers shade and aesthetic appeal. However, its rapid growth and potential invasiveness must be carefully considered.
Rapid Growth and Shade Potential
Albizia trees grow quickly, providing ample shade in a relatively short period.
This makes them a popular choice for creating a cool, sheltered outdoor space.
Addressing Invasiveness
Some Albizia species are considered invasive in certain regions due to their prolific seed production and ability to outcompete native plants.
Before planting an Albizia, research its invasiveness potential in your area. Consider choosing a less invasive variety or implementing measures to control its spread, such as removing seed pods before they mature.
Pruning Considerations
Regular pruning is essential to manage the Albizia's growth and prevent it from becoming too large or unruly.
Prune during the dormant season to avoid excessive sap bleeding. Remove any suckers that emerge from the base of the tree.
Mimosa pudica: The Sensitive Wonder
Mimosa pudica, also known as the "sensitive plant," is renowned for its fascinating ability to fold its leaves inward when touched. This unique characteristic makes it a captivating addition to any garden, but it also requires specific care.
Understanding its Sensitivity
The leaf-folding response is a defense mechanism against herbivores.
Avoid excessive touching, as it can stress the plant.
Environmental Needs
Mimosa pudica thrives in warm, humid environments.
It prefers well-drained soil and bright, indirect sunlight. Protect it from frost and cold temperatures.
Watering and Humidity
Keep the soil consistently moist but not waterlogged. Mimosa pudica benefits from high humidity.
You can increase humidity by misting the plant regularly or placing it near a humidifier.
